ABET Definitions • Outcomes: what students can do when they
graduate. Most successful measures: assessment of course work, and senior surveys.– Department assesses outcomes.
• Objectives: what graduates can do after several years. IAB input (revise objectives) and alumni surveys (measure achievement of objectives). – COE carries out surveys. Department analyzes them.

Program Objectives, defined 2005-2006, no need to revise since)
A graduate of the University of Florida Computer Engineering Program should have a successful career in computer engineering or a related field, and within three to five years, should:
1. Excel in a career utilizing their education in Computer Engineering;
2. Continue to enhance their knowledge; 3. Be effective in multidisciplinary and diverse
professional environments;4. Provide leadership and demonstrate good citizenship.

Outcomes: a CEN graduate should have ...
(a) an ability to apply knowledge of mathematics, statistics, computer science, and electrical engineering as it applies to computer hardware and software;
(b) an ability to design and conduct experiments, as well as to organize, analyze and interpret data;
(c) an ability to design hardware and software systems, components, or processes to meet desired needs within realistic constraints such as economic, environmental, social, political, ethical, health and safety, manufacturability, and sustainability;
(d) an ability to function on multi-disciplinary teams;

Outcomes (cont'd). A CEN graduate should have …
(e) an ability to identify, formulate, and solve hardware and software computer engineering problems, accounting for the interaction between hardware and software;
(f) an understanding of professional, legal, and ethical issues and responsibilities;
(g) an ability to communicate effectively in speech and in writing, including documentation of hardware and software systems;
(h) the broad education necessary to understand the impact of engineering solutions in a global, economic, environmental, and societal context;

Outcomes (cont’d) A CEN graduate should have …
(i) a recognition of the need for, and an ability to engage in life-long learning;
(j) a knowledge of contemporary issues;(k) an ability to use the techniques, skills, and modern
engineering tools necessary for computer engineering practice; and
(l) an ability to apply engineering and management knowledge and techniques to estimate time and resources needed to complete a computer engineering project.

Program Improvements in Self-Study
• COP-3530 in C++ beginning Summer 2010. • Cover Java threading and synchronization in
Operating Systems (a pre-req for Computer Networking ).
• Add one more lab hour to CIS-3020 (now COP-3504)
• CIS-3020, 3022, 3023 (now COP-3504, 3502, 3503) now allow only individual student work.
• MATLAB lab component added to EEL-3135 Signals and Systems.
